At Woodmansterne Station, you'll find a range of amenities designed to make your journey as smooth as possible. While the ticket office opens weekdays from 06:10 to 10:40, rest assured that there are automated ticket machines ready to serve you outside these hours. For added convenience, you can collect tickets bought online directly from the station's ticket machines. Smartcard users will be pleased to know that smartcard validators are available, ensuring a swift passage through the station.
In terms of accessibility, Woodmansterne might present some challenges as it does not have step-free access, so plan accordingly if mobility is a concern. Helpful station staff are on hand during specific hours on weekdays, ready to assist with any queries or needs you might have. Despite the absence of waiting rooms, there is seating available for travelers on the platform.
If you're cycling to the station, there are 10 secure bicycle stands sheltered and monitored by CCTV to ensure your bike's safety while you travel. While there are no on-site shops or refreshment facilities to speak of, the station provides an ATM for any quick cash needs you may have.

Millbrook might be small, but it offers essential amenities for its travelers. However, keep in mind that there is no ticket office or ticket machines on-site, so purchasing tickets online prior is recommended. The presence of an induction loop makes communication accessible for those with hearing impairments. Additionally, there are help points available, although no staff assistance is offered at this station.
Accessibility is a significant focus here, with step-free access available, albeit with possible long or steep ramps between platforms. Note that there is no waiting room, and while seating is available, other amenities such as toilets, refreshment facilities, and a car park are absent.
